- Seanad: Social Welfare and Pensions Bill 2013: Motion for Earlier Signature (7 Nov 2013)
Maurice Cummins: I move: That, pursuant to subsection 2° of section 2 of Article 25 of the Constitution, Seanad Éireann concurs with the Government in a request to the President to sign the Social Welfare and Pensions Bill 2013 on a date which is earlier than the fifth day after the date on which the Bill shall have been presented to him.
